feat(execution-engine)!: make fold convergent wrt errors (#351)
fold over a stream was not convergent when errors are produced inside a fold body. After iteration, it produces if there were several errors, only the last one is bubbled up. But on the same peer, there could different last (and first) errors, and it'll become non-convergent and moreover non-deterministic.

After this PR fold won't bubble any errors to make execution convergent and deterministic. To obtain errors from a fold body one should wrap this body into xor and push errors into some stream. Then fold over this stream and handle errors.

feat(execution-engine): change behaviour of fold over streams (#340)
feat(execution-engine): change behaviour of fold over streams

Change behaviour of fold over streams to make it more similar to pi-calculus channels/names (for more info see #333).

Closes #333.

BREAKING CHANGE:

The new stream behaviour is not compatible with old one, such as
```
(fold $stream iterator
   (seq
       (call ...)
       (next iterator)))
```
will never end after this change (for more info again see #333).

Testing framework, chapter I (#293)
Testing framework for AquaVM

Its primary features are:
1. It generates services declaratively by annotation in the comments inserted just after calls.
2. Ephemeral network keeps each node's data and incoming data queue.  The network can be also generated based on peer IDs featured in the script.
3. One can explicitly add additional peers and services.

The example of the script annotations:
```
(seq
  (call "peer_1" ("service" "func") [] var) ; ok=42
  (call "peer_2" ("service" "func") [var]) ; err={"ret_code": 1, "result":"no towel"}
)
```

Passing this script to `air_test_framework::TestExecutor::new(...)` will create a virtual network with peers "peer_1" and "peer_2" (and any peer you provide in the `TestRunParameters`), and the particular calls will return respective values.

Please note that autogenerated services use modified service name as a side channel for finding a correct value: "..{N}" is added to each service name (two dots and serial number).  Be careful with service names taken from a variable.

dcfa51c756 Use pooled AVMRunner for tests
Use pooled `avm::server::AVMRunner` instances of
air_iterpreter_server.wasm to reduce tests' running time.  It avoids
repeated WASM loading and compilation.

On my hardware, `cargo test --release` execution time (precompiled)
decreases from almost 6 minutes to 1.5 minutes.
